Job Requisition ID #26WD94900About The Team: You will work with a cross-functional team within Autodesk Research, including members of the Simulation, Optimization and Systems, Industry Futures, and Engineering organizations. Together, the team explores the future of product assembly and design , bridging research, advanced engineering, and real-world, design to manufacturing workflows for Autodesk’s customers.As a member of the team, you will have access to state-of-the-art workshops and manufacturing expertise within the Autodesk Toronto Technology Centre.About The Role: As an Intern at Autodesk, you will be immersed in driving and owning projects that directly impact our customers, internal teams, or core products. You will work alongside cross functional teams and mentors within Autodesk Research, gaining hands-on experience to further drive personal growth while contributing to early-stage research and prototype development. In this role you will investigate and prototype how AI can be leveraged to improve the design and manufacturability of mechanical assemblies. You will explore the integration of AI/ML methods in CAD/CAM, computational geometry and system’s engineering workflows to improve design fidelity, support trade-off analysis and accelerate design-to-manufacturing decision making.Responsibilities:Having a dedicated mentor who will help you navigate through Autodesk from Day 1 – all while showing you what it means to be an Autodesker!
